WebDec 15, 2024 · Depending on the variety, most grass seeds have an small, oblong shape. Unlike larger seed types, grass sprouts cannot push through a thick soil layer because the new growth is tiny and sensitive. WebMar 22, 2024 · The pH level of soil is measured on a scale of 0 to 14, with 7 being neutral. Grass generally grows best in soil with a pH level between 6.0 and 7.5. If the pH level is …
